Raspberry Vanilla Cupcakes Recipe

Ingredients

To create these Raspberry Vanilla Cupcakes, you will need the following ingredients:

1. 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our

2. 1 1/2 tsp baking powder

3. 1/4 tsp salt

4. 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ened

5. 1 cup granulated sugar

6. 2 large eggs

7. 1 tsp vanilla extract

8. 1/2 cup milk

9. 1 cup fresh raspberries

10. For the frosting: 1/2 cup unsalted butter, 2 cups powdered sugar, 1 tsp vanilla extract, 2-3 tbsp milk

Steps

Follow these steps to create your Raspberry Vanilla Cupcakes:

1. Preheat your oven to 350°F and line a cupcake pan with paper liners.

2. In a b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t.

3. In a separate bowl, cream the butter and sugar together until light and fluffy.

4.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.

5.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, alternating with the milk.

6. Gently fold in the raspberries, being careful not to overmix the batter.

7. Divide the batter evenly among the cupcake liners and bake for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.

8. Allow the cupcakes to cool completely before frosting.

Variations

There are several ways to customize your Raspberry Vanilla Cupcakes:

1. Add lemon zest to the batter for a hint of citrus freshness.

2. Substitute almond extract for the vanilla extract for a different flavor profile.

3. Top the cupcakes with a dollop of raspberry jam before frosting for an extra burst of flavor.

4. Experiment with different frosting flavors such as cream cheese or white chocolate.

Tips

Here are some useful tips to ensure your Raspberry Vanilla Cupcakes turn out perfectly:

1. Use fresh raspberries for the best flavor and texture.

2. Do not overmix the batter once the raspberries are added to avoid crushing them.

3. Allow the cupcakes to cool completely before frosting to prevent the frosting from melting.

4. Store the cupcakes in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days.

FAQs

Here are some frequently asked questions about Raspberry Vanilla Cupcakes:

Q: Can I use frozen raspberries instead of fresh ones?

A: While fresh raspberries are recommended for the best flavor, you can use frozen raspberries that have been thawed and drained.

Q: How can I make the frosting ahead of time?

A: You can prepare the frosting and store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. Allow it to come to room temperature before frosting the cupcakes.

Q: Can I make these cupcakes gluten-free?

A: You can use a gluten-free flour blend in place of all-purpose flour to make these cupcakes gluten-free. Ensure all other ingredients are also gluten-free.

Q: Can I freeze leftover cupcakes?

A: Yes, you can freeze unfrosted cupcakes in an airtight container for up to three months. Thaw them at room temperature before frosting and serving.
